Recent protests outside the offices of leading AI companies in San Francisco—including OpenAI, Anthropic, and xAI—have sparked a significant conversation about the future of artificial intelligence. Activists are calling for a temporary halt to the development of advanced AI systems, fueling debates around ethical implications, safety concerns, and societal impacts of these technologies.

The Good, The Bad, and The Ugly of AI Development

The Good

The rapid development of AI technologies promises significant advancements across various sectors, from healthcare to finance. AI systems can analyze vast datasets, leading to breakthroughs in medical research, personalized education, and even climate change solutions. The potential for innovation is staggering, with AI expected to enhance productivity and create new economic opportunities. Protesters recognize this potential but emphasize that progress should not come at the expense of safety and ethical considerations.

The Bad

However, the unregulated and relentless pursuit of AI advancement raises concerns. Critics argue that current AI systems are implemented without thorough understanding or regulation, leading to potentially harmful consequences. Issues such as bias in AI algorithms, privacy violations, and job displacement are significant threats that require immediate attention. The current protest highlights a growing unease in the public regarding the pace of AI development and a lack of mechanisms to hold developers accountable for the implications of their technologies.

The Ugly

In the worst-case scenarios, unchecked AI development could lead to catastrophic outcomes. Concerns about autonomous weapon systems, surveillance technologies, and the exacerbation of inequality are valid and pressing. The protests serve as a reminder of the power dynamics at play as massive AI firms develop technologies that can outpace regulatory frameworks. If these concerns are not addressed, we may end up in a dystopian future where AI operates without ethical considerations or human oversight.

Market Context

The protests come at a time when the AI industry is booming, with investments pouring in at unprecedented rates. In 2023 alone, venture capital funding for AI startups has reached record highs, reflecting the sector's explosive growth. However, this rapid influx of capital can lead to a 'move fast and break things' mentality that prioritizes speed and profit over safety and ethical considerations. Regulatory bodies around the world are beginning to address these issues, but the pace of regulation often lags behind technological advancements.

Investors need to be aware of the shifting landscape. Growing public concerns and potential regulatory changes could impact the profitability and operational models of AI companies. The recent protests might signal a turning point in how AI development is perceived, creating an environment in which investors must consider ethical implications alongside financial returns.

Impact on Investors

For investors, the protests signify a critical juncture in the AI sector. Here are several key considerations:

  1. Regulatory Risks: Increased pressure for regulation could lead to operational constraints for AI companies, impacting their bottom line.
  2. Public Sentiment: Investors need to monitor public sentiment towards AI development as protests reflect a growing mistrust that can affect company reputations and stock values.
  3. Ethical Investment: There’s a rising demand for ethical investment, and companies that prioritize safety, transparency, and ethical considerations may gain competitive advantages.
  4. Long-Term Viability: Companies that fail to address ethical concerns may face backlash, while those that embrace these discussions could build stronger, more sustainable business models.
